Bloomberg reports that Amazon, Apple, DirecTV, Disney, and Google are interested in local NBA rights, “but only if they can obtain a critical mass of teams.”


The Diamond Sports Group, owner of the Bally Sports RSNs, has been moving through the bankruptcy process since March. Three teams have left the Bally Sports RSNs since – the Arizona Diamondbacks and San Diego Padres were dropped by Diamond and are having their games produced and distributed by MLB, while the Phoenix Suns voluntarily left for a new deal with Gray Television and Kiswe.

15 NBA teams, or a full half of the league, still have their local games broadcast on Bally Sports RSNs. Unlike MLB, Diamond has an all-encompassing streaming deal with the NBA, allowing it to offer live NBA games on its Bally Sports+ service.

Much of what will happen with the media rights for those 15 teams, as well as the other teams still in the Diamond portfolio, hinge on whether or not the company can get new carriage deals done with Comcast and DirecTV, which expire shortly.

The NBA wants to avoid turmoil and is seeking certainty from Diamond that it will continue paying teams and airing their games next season.
